[
https://issues.apache.org/jira/browse/SOLR-12074?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16691097#comment-16691097
]
Yonik Seeley commented on SOLR-12074:
-------------------------------------
bq. It'd be nifty if PointField could additionally have a Terms index for these
full-precision terms instead of requiring a separate field in the schema.
+1, it's important for it to be the same field in the schema for both
usability, and so that solr knows how to optimize single-valued lookups.
If we could turn back time, I'd argue for keeping "indexed=true" in the schema
to mean normal full-text index, and then use another name for the BKD structure
(rangeIndexed=true? pointIndexed=true?), but I guess that ship has sailed.
So what should the name of the new flag for the schema be?
valueIndexed?
termIndexed?
> Add numeric typed equivalents to StrField
> -----------------------------------------
>
> Key: SOLR-12074
> URL: https://issues.apache.org/jira/browse/SOLR-12074
> Project: Solr
> Issue Type: New Feature
> Security Level: Public(Default Security Level. Issues are Public)
> Components: Schema and Analysis
> Reporter: David Smiley
> Priority: Major
> Labels: newdev, numeric-tries-to-points
>
> There ought to be numeric typed equivalents to StrField in the schema. The
> TrieField types can be configured to do this with precisionStep=0, but the
> TrieFields are deprecated and slated for removal in 8.0. PointFields may be
> adequate for some use cases but, unlike TrieField, it's not as efficient for
> simple field:value lookup queries. They probably should use the same
> internal sortable full-precision term format that TrieField uses (details
> currently in {{LegacyNumericUtils}} (which are used by the deprecated Trie
> fields).
--
This message was sent by Atlassian JIRA
(v7.6.3#76005)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]